Doubting Thomas, through the eye of a needle. Eating fish on Friday, chocolate eggs with Easter. Celebrating Saint-Martin, Saint-Nicholas and Father Christmas. What do these expressions, customs and holidays have in common? That’s right, they are all rooted in various religious traditions.

In this exhibition you will discover that many contemporary idioms, symbols, holidays and customs are shaped by Christian traditions present in our region. Even when at first glance you would not connect them to religion at all.

Beyond belief, you might say. Discover the origins of ‘hocus-pocus’, Saint-John’s wort, the unicorn, the Christmas tree, hearts on Saint-Valentine’s Day and pumpkins on Halloween. Be amazed by the myriad of present-day examples.
